Output 43c3a50bcb36afb2cecf52f47353148aadd5361ef2444c3144f8021eaff58305:0

value
11445546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ab14d39c82d7a948ed95fe7e1887e1f39c923ae OP_EQUAL
address
3HFZCHoGwefamu56XoPu64pvRyFw88Mdbw
transaction
43c3a50bcb36afb2cecf52f47353148aadd5361ef2444c3144f8021eaff58305
spent
true